Goal of the Activity

This edition of the National Erasmus Game promoted physical and mental well-being with the added value of creating social aggregation, but also respect for nature, fight against climate change and environmental sustainability. 

The activities on the side of the sports competitions also aimed to promote the themes of the Food Wave project as well as food sustainability and environmentally friendly lifestyles among the participants, spectators and event organizers, offering fresh fruits and water as well as local and sustainable food during the event. 

 

Description

The National Erasmus Games, or NEG, were held in Milan starting from the 22nd of April 2022, the International Hearth Day, until the 24th in Centro Sportivo Saini in Milan. During these three days of the event, Erasmus from Northern to Southern Italy, accompanied by local students, met to participate in real Erasmus National Olympics. Students from 52 different Countries had the opportunity to compete by representing the 15 ESN Sections they belong to during their exchange program in Italy. The event has been an opportunity to promote a healthier and more sustainable lifestyle: indeed, the event was part of the Food Wave Project. 

Throughout the days, the competing sports were mixed basketball (5x5),mixed football (5x5), mixed volleyball (5x5), 100 meters men and women and 1500 men and women. The participation saw 377 International and Italian youths coming from 52 different countries and studying in 15 different Italian Universities; 31 of them involved in the organization and 346 athletes. Comune di Milano, ActionAid and Yes Milano took part in the event as well as ResponsibleParty promoting a healthy and sustainable lifestyle. 

The event was opened on Friday morning by a conference on the importance of leading a healthy lifestyle, adopting a sustainable diet and sports as a tool for social integration and improving health, both physical and mental, during which the Councillor for Sports, Tourism and Youth Policies of the City of Milan and representatives of various institutions and associations related to the world of sports and sustainability spoke.

The event continued with the 2-day sports tournaments, and concluded on Sunday with the offer of different types of city tours from which participants could choose. 

The top finishers in each sport were selected to participate in the IEGs in Coimbra, Portugal, in May.

Also prior to the event, on April 14 with a press conference was held at Palazzo Marino, the seat of the city administration, which was attended by the City of Milan and representatives of the food wave project, as well as the presence and support of the Milan sections.
